South Carolina’s jazz scene shines brightly in Greenville, thanks to the Greenville Jazz Collective.
Formed by passionate local musicians, this group is dedicated to nurturing jazz talent and bringing live jazz to the community. Their mission? Keep the tradition alive while pushing the music forward with fresh energy and creativity.
From regular concerts and workshops to collaborations with schools and festivals, the Greenville Jazz Collective creates spaces where jazz lovers of all ages can gather, learn, and celebrate.
What makes them special is their deep commitment to education and mentorship, cultivating the next generation of jazz artists while honoring the legacy of those who came before.
They preserve jazz and make it vibrant, relevant, and accessible here in the Palmetto State.
